D&H United Fueling Solutions, Inc., a fast-growing
leader in the petroleum services industry, is looking for experienced,
energetic, hardworking construction technicians. The primary duties of the construction technician
are to assist in the installation of underground and aboveground storage tanks,
piping, electrical, excavating, busting and removal of concrete, re-pouring of concrete,
installing dispensers, and other petroleum related work while providing
complete customer satisfaction in a polite and professional manner, and
maintaining excellent safety standards.

Responsibilities:
- Using heavy equipment to
dig ditches, manually install equipment - Work with concrete,
framing, pouring, mixing, finishing - Must be willing to travel and work
out of town (including overnight stays) - Ensure all safe work practices
are followed at all times - Ensure safe housekeeping practices are followed at all times,
including job cleanup at the end of each day - Installation and repair of
petroleum equipment including USTs, ASTs, gas pumps, fuel monitoring
systems, submersible pumps, and product piping - Conduct work on
construction projects, concrete removal and replacement, manhole and spill
containment replacements’ - Assure compliance with
appropriate safety practices and procedures according to applicable
federal, state, and local codes, regulations and company guidelines - Maintain tools and
equipment to ensure all are in proper and safe working order - Other tasks as requested by
management
